Just applied for my first preference point. You can get 2 per year so it takes quite a few to get a license.
I spoke to the NWTF CO president and asked about the whole preference point thing for the draw only units and he told me he just goes west of his home (Woodland Park) and gets one every year on NFS land. Get your points up but not needed. THe spot I whent to last year is an over the counter unit and I saw plenty. No I didn't get one[Bang] but this is the year. I can feel it.[Rant2]
